Daily Life In Mexico City
Migrants who are stranded in Mexico City, Mexico, on August 27, 2024, attend the Mexican Commission for Refugee Assistance to process a permit that allows them to stay longer in Mexico due to the difficulties their compatriots have in entering the United States. They also wait for a permit or ''Visitor Card for Humanitarian Reasons'' that allows them to access health services and employment opportunities in Mexico while they are being cared for and to continue their journey to the border.
